August 15, 2005The Fair TaxBoortz has a book out, #1 NYT best seller non-fiction The FairTax Book. The Fair Tax is a not a novel idea and as legislation cannot hope to repeal the 16th Amendment. Hopefully, however, those paleo-libs who disparage the Fair Tax (and school-vouchers, among other reform proposals) will realize that it is movement in a better direction. It is also possible that Americans will, after a few years without it, be ready to repeal the 16th Amendment, but that all depends on whether they can first get a taste of life without April 15th. Objections to making private enterprise the tax collecter for the welfare state are duly noted, but we've got to start somewhere and there isn't a single uber libertarian-principled proposal out there that will gain popular support.
